Technicians of Tooth Activity



Understanding exactly how teeth move during orthodontic treatment is essential for both orthodontists and clients to realize the auto mechanics of tooth activity. When pressure is put on a tooth, it launches a procedure called bone makeover. This procedure entails the failure and restoring of bone tissue to permit the tooth to relocate into its correct setting. The stress applied by braces or aligners causes a cascade of events within the gum tendon, leading to the repositioning of the tooth.

Tooth activity takes place in action to the force used and the body's all-natural feedback to that pressure. As the tooth actions, bone is resorbed on one side and transferred on the various other. This continuous cycle of bone renovation allows the tooth to shift gradually gradually. Orthodontists carefully prepare the direction and quantity of force needed to accomplish the desired activity, taking into consideration elements such as tooth origin length and bone density.

Furthermore, innovations in 3D imaging modern technology have actually made it possible for orthodontists to create specific treatment plans tailored to every person's distinct dental framework. Cone beam computed tomography (CBCT) scans supply comprehensive 3D photos of the teeth, roots, and jaw, permitting even more precise medical diagnosis and treatment.



One more noteworthy innovation in contemporary orthodontics is making use of accelerated orthodontics techniques. These techniques, such as AcceleDent and Drive, help accelerate the tooth motion procedure, reducing treatment time considerably.
